Abstract

The invention discloses a rainwater treatment system and a rainwater treatment construction method for a house roof. The rainwater treatment system comprises a rainwater collection pipe network, a rainwater stand pipe, a rotational flow filter device, a rainwater collection pool and rainwater fetching systems. The rainwater collection pipe network comprises flashings and a rainwater collection tank. The rainwater fetching systems are internally provided with rainwater fetching pipes and pressure control pumps. The rainwater treatment construction method comprises the steps of (a), paving of the flashings; (b), mounting of the rainwater collection tank on the roof; (c), mounting of the rainwater stand pipe on a wall; (d), excavation of a foundation pit; (e), mounting of the rotational flow filter device in the foundation pit; (f), arrangement of the rainwater collection pool; and (g), mounting of the rainwater fetching systems into the rainwater collection pool. The rainwater treatment system and the rainwater treatment construction method are used for collecting, filtering, purifying, storing and utilizing rainwater on the roof and can be used for an undrinkable water environment, the resource utilization efficiency of the rainwater is improved, waste is turned into wealth, water resource shortage is relieved, the construction steps are simple and low in difficulty, the construction quality is easy to control, the construction cost is low, and the number of involved construction equipment is small.

technical field

[0001] The invention belongs to the technical field of water resource utilization, and in particular relates to a house roof rainwater treatment system and a construction method. Background technique

[0002] With the advancement of urbanization, the increase of ground hardening has changed the original hydrological characteristics, resulting in increased rainwater runoff, frequent water accumulation on the road surface, and frequent large-scale water accumulation in some cities. The drop in groundwater level has intensified. In addition, the problem of water shortage in my country's cities is becoming more and more serious. The resource-based water shortage in the northern region and the water quality-based water shortage in the southern region. In this environment, the government proposed the goal of building a "sponge city" and supported it in various aspects such as policy and finance.

Embodiment Construction

[0029] Such as Figure 1 to Figure 5 Shown is a house roof rainwater treatment system in the present invention, including a rainwater collection pipe network 1, a rainwater standpipe 2, a cyclone filter device 3, a rainwater collection tank 4 and a water intake system 5.

[0030] The rainwater collecting pipe network 1 includes a flashing plate 6 and a collecting water tank 7 , and the flashing plate 6 is connected to the collecting water tank 7 . Two adjacent flashing boards 6 on the left and right are fixedly connected, a U-shaped steel 8 is arranged between the two adjacent left and right flashing boards 6, a spacer 9 is arranged on the U-shaped steel 8, and a horizontal pipe 10 is arranged on the spacer 9, and the horizontal pipe 10 is arranged on the spacer 9. The pipe 10 is connected to the collection tank 7 . Both sides of the flashing board 6 are provided with support plates 16, and the U-shaped steel 8 is arranged on the support board 16.
